docker會不會被替代
近年來,由於雲端運算和微服務的流行,Docker成為了最受歡迎的容器化技術之一。然而,隨著科技的不斷發展,人們開始質疑Docker是否能持續領先。本文將從多個角度探討Docker是否會被取代。
- 競爭對手的崛起
眾所周知,Docker的最大競爭對手就是Kubernetes。 Kubernetes是一個由Google發起的開源容器編排工具,用於管理Docker容器。 Kubernetes提供了更多的功能,如自動擴展、滾動升級和故障轉移等,這些功能Docker必須透過第三方工具才能實現。因此,有些人認為Kubernetes可能會取代Docker成為容器編排的主要工具。
- 安全與效能問題
儘管Docker已經成為雲端運算和DevOps環境中最受歡迎的容器化解決方案,但它仍存在一些安全性和效能問題。漏洞、容器之間的隔離不充分、容器資源共享等問題可能影響容器化的安全性和效能。這也成為了一些人開始尋找Docker替代方案的原因之一。
- 雲端廠商的相容性
另外,許多雲端廠商為了獲得更高的市場份額,開始推出自己的容器編排工具。例如,AWS推出了ECS,Google推出了GKE,Microsoft推出了AKS。這些雲端廠商的容器編排工具與Docker相容性不同,使得企業在多雲環境下使用時可能需要額外的部署和監管。
- 開源社群的貢獻
隨著開源社群的發展,有越來越多的人開始對Docker進行最佳化和改進。新的技術對Docker可能會產生影響,例如rkt和containerd等。 rkt是由CoreOS公司開發的一種容器執行時間工具。與Docker不同,rkt提供了更高的安全性和隔離性。而containerd則是Docker在2016年發布的開源容器運行時,它可以被用於開發、建置和運行容器,並支援多種容器格式。這些項目都顯示Docker替代品的存在。
儘管Docker面臨來自Kubernetes、安全問題、雲端廠商相容性和開源社群貢獻的競爭和挑戰,它仍然是DevOps環境中最受歡迎的容器解決方案之一。 Docker的優秀和普及度可以增強其市場佔有率和競爭優勢,同時也激勵Docker繼續改進和創新。
總之,Docker在現今容器編排市場上依舊處於領先地位,不過它也需要跟進市場的變化,並不斷完善自身的技術,以保持其競爭優勢。無論如何,Docker的出現在雲端運算和微服務領域中,已經帶給了我們極大的便利和改進,促進了這些領域的發展,值得我們深入研究和持續關注。
以上是docker會不會被替代的詳細內容。更多資訊請關注PHP中文網其他相關文章!

熱AI工具

Undresser.AI Undress
人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over
用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ool
免費脫衣圖片

Clothoff.io
AI脫衣器

AI Hentai Generator
免費產生 AI 無盡。

熱門文章

熱工具

記事本++7.3.1
好用且免費的程式碼編輯器

SublimeText3漢化版
中文版,非常好用

禪工作室 13.0.1
強大的PHP整合開發環境

Dreamweaver CS6
視覺化網頁開發工具

SublimeText3 Mac版
神級程式碼編輯軟體(SublimeText3)

熱門話題

本文解釋了Kubernetes的吊艙,部署和服務,詳細說明了它們在管理容器化應用程序中的作用。它討論了這些組件如何增強應用程序內的可擴展性,穩定性和通信。(159個字符)

本文使用手動縮放,HPA,VPA和集群Autoscaler討論了Kubernetes中的擴展應用程序,並提供了監視和自動化縮放的最佳實踐和工具。

本文討論了Docker Swarm中實施滾動更新以更新服務而無需停機。它涵蓋更新服務,設置更新參數,監視進度並確保更新。

Docker是DevOps工程師必備的技能。 1.Docker是開源的容器化平台,通過將應用程序及其依賴打包到容器中,實現隔離和可移植性。 2.Docker的工作原理包括命名空間、控制組和聯合文件系統。 3.基本用法包括創建、運行和管理容器。 4.高級用法包括使用DockerCompose管理多容器應用。 5.常見錯誤有容器無法啟動、端口映射問題和數據持久化問題,調試技巧包括查看日誌、進入容器和查看詳細信息。 6.性能優化和最佳實踐包括鏡像優化、資源限制、網絡優化和使用Dockerfile的最佳實踐。
